Great Lakes College Corp. is just one of seven business that service federal loan debt by gathering as well as tracking repayments. If Great Lakes is your trainee loan servicer, here’s what it can aid you do.
Register for on the internet accessibility to your account. As soon as you have access you can contact Great Lakes, access your monthly billing statements as well as pay expenses.
Enlist in autopay. Great Lakes Loans can subtract your payments automatically from your bank account. Signing up for autopay will reduce your passion by 0.25 portion point.
Enroll in income-driven settlement. You can request income-driven repayment, which restricts your student loan repayments to a percentage of your revenue, by finishing a paper kind with Great Lakes. (You can apply online on studentaid.gov and then recertify your earnings every year online as well.).
Refine deferment and also forbearance demands. Great Lakes can assist you briefly quit making payments or decrease your settlement amount if you certify. This helps you remain in excellent standing to avoid default. But during any type of periods of deferment or forbearance, rate of interest can remain to develop.
Process monthly repayments and also extra payments. Great Lakes will track and collect your payments. If you want to make added payments, you can advise Great Lakes (online, by phone or by mail) to apply added settlements to your existing equilibrium. Or else, it may apply the extra total up to next month’s payment instead.

Your loan servicer is appointed by the U.S. Division of Education when your loan is disbursed to your university for the very first time. The name of the business sending you a government loan costs on a monthly basis is your servicer. If your loan payments have not begun or you’re uncertain which firm is your servicer, visit to My Federal Trainee Aid to discover. You can additionally get in touch with any of the loan servicer get in touch with centers by calling 1-800-4-FED-AID.
Servicers exist to assist you, however they may use options that are best for the business, not the consumer. That implies they can’t alter exactly how settlements are processed and also might not recommend one of the most valuable payment choice for you. It’s crucial to know your payment alternatives so you can understand the appropriate concerns to ask.
If Great Lakes reported your account in error during car forbearance.
Nearly 5 million debtors whose federal pupil loans are serviced by Great Lakes may have seen their credit report dip due to the fact that their debts were mistakenly reported to the major credit history bureaus throughout the automatic six-month forbearance that started in March 2020.
Your stopped briefly repayments might have been reported as “delayed” as a result of a coding error. The stopped repayments ought to have been reported as if you had made them. If you were current when forbearance started, for instance, the standing ought to be “present.”.
Deferred status is not a racking up factor under FICO credit rating formulas, the ones most typically used to make lending choices. But deferred status can reduce the credit scores created by VantageScore solutions– the scores most frequently supplied absolutely free to consumers as a means to track their credit rating.
Great Lakes says it is dealing with credit report coverage firms to deal with the mistakes. As soon as the info on the underlying credit record is appropriate, credit rating must be unaffected.
Debtors need to inspect their credit records from each of the 3 credit history reporting bureaus at AnnualCreditReport.com, the complimentary, government-run web site.
Great Lakes asks that customers contact it straight if their credit scores records are incorrect. Call 800-236-4300. Obtain extra details on speaking to Great Lakes client service or making a grievance right here.
Am I stuck to Great Lakes until my loans are paid off?
Loans are often moved from one servicer to an additional by the Division of Education.
The Department of Education and learning is intending to shift the pupil loan servicing landscape by signing new maintenance agreements with 5 firms to ultimately take over all loan maintenance. That indicates your loan servicer is most likely to change. Great Lakes is arranged to continue servicing loans through December 2023.
Prior to servicing agreements ending, borrowers need to do the following:.
Download as well as conserve your repayment background from your online account or request a copy from your servicer.
Update your call info with your most recent address, phone number and also e-mail address.
You’ll be notified when a loan maintenance transfer happens, and you’ll take care of repayments with the new servicer. All servicers provide the very same choices and programs, yet customer support might vary from one to an additional.
